Lil Baby Brings Out YFN Lucci in Atlanta, Squashing Rumored Beef During WHAM Tour Stop

Lil Baby is back on the road for his highly anticipated WHAM album tour, and his stop in his hometown of Atlanta on Saturday (June 7) delivered more than just a high-energy performance—it offered a surprising and powerful moment of reconciliation.

In front of a packed crowd, Lil Baby brought out fellow Atlanta rapper YFN Lucci as a surprise guest. The crowd erupted as Lucci hit the stage to perform his fan-favorite track “Heartless.” The two artists shared multiple daps and exchanged mutual respect, signaling what many took as an end to long-rumored tensions between them.

For years, hip-hop fans speculated about an unspoken beef between Lil Baby and YFN Lucci, although neither artist ever confirmed anything outright. Still, tensions were assumed due to their affiliations and respective crews. Saturday’s public link-up put that speculation to rest.

The moment was even more noteworthy given Lucci’s other high-profile rap conflicts, most infamously with Young Thug and his YSL collective—of which Lil Baby has long been considered an affiliate and supporter. While it’s unclear if Baby’s move signals a broader peace initiative among Atlanta artists, fans took the moment as a hopeful sign.

As social media flooded with clips from the performance, the general sentiment was clear: fans love seeing growth, healing, and unity in a genre that has too often been marred by real-life feuds.
